BEST NEIGHBORS EVER! | Cubs vs. Sox Leads to a Forever Friendship

Updated: Sep 2, 2020



by Brianna Bartemeyer


MEET THE LOID, LOID-RICHERT & SCIABICA FAMILIES

NAPERVILLE–Call it ‘The Crosstown Classic’, ‘The Windy City Showdown’ or ‘The North-South Showdown’. These catch phrases are synonymous with the highly anticipated Chicago Cubs-White Sox rivalry series … and bragging rights for the rest of the year. Chicago is just one of four lucky cities in the U.S. to have two MLB teams. Unfortunately, team loyalty is not understood by many - often adding strain to relationships. The Loid, Loid-Richert and Sciabica families are defying the odds!

In 2005, The Sciabicas moved into their new home in Naperville. Excited to raise their three children and meet new neighbors, they proudly hung their Cubs’ flag. Little did they know, the neighbors (Loids/Loid-Richerts) were die-hard White Sox fans. This friendly rivalry soon led to backyard watch parties and road trips.



Over the years, they’ve opened their homes (and yards!) to Sunday Fundays - bring on the mimosas and muffins! And we can’t forget to give Ryan Richert’s infamous ‘Mickey waffles’ a shout out! During our close-to-intolerable winter months (ie: ‘The Polar Vortex’), Joe Sciabica and Ryan Richert started the Suburban Bourbon & Cigar Club - they kindly allow Don Loid to partake with his beloved Bud Light.


These neighbors continue to find ways to celebrate life together - if it’s not Sunday Fundays, it’s weekend movie nights, casino nights, vacations, birthdays and weddings. As baseball legend Yogi Berra once said, “When you come to a fork in the road, take it.” Even through differences (ahem - rivalries!), we hope you too find friendships that turn into family.
